Puff Daddy was as big a force in Hip Hop history as there’s ever been.

He’s also been exposed as a violent sex pest who may end up locked up for the rest of his life.

TMZ asked The Diddler’s NYC contemporary Method Man if the crimes of Puff damaged the rap game and perhaps even spelled “the end of Hip Hop.”

He said they didn’t.

“I don’t think that it has anything to do with hip hop. What are we talking about here, really,” he said.  “It has nothing to do with hip hop at all so I don’t see the correlation. If we’re talking about music and creative and stuff,” Meth noted. “There are people still listening to R. Kelly sh*t.”
